**FAQ: Upgrading to Relaybarn 4.x — will my plugins break?**

Mostly no. Relaybarn 4.x keeps the 3.x consumer API, but plugins that touch the wire protocol directly must migrate to the framed codec. Test against the shadow broker before upgrading production. During the upgrade window, plugin certificates are re-issued from the escrow store, which you unlock with the recovery passphrase shown below.

unlock words, yaduf-kagep: holdor-fraox-giliel

Finance Review Summary — Q2 Budget Request, Sales Division

Sales leads: the requested uplift for the Pindle Ridge expansion has been reviewed in detail. Travel and demo-kit lines were trimmed 6 percent; headcount funding for the Calverstone pods is approved in full. Remaining variance sits within tolerance, pending final sign-off by the Vexley committee. Please align your pipeline forecasts accordingly. The confidential strategic note follows below.

internal memo for yahag-hahig: Belwynix Group plans to lower the Silir list price by 62 percent in May.

All version bumps to the Larkspur shared component library follow semantic versioning, and any major release requires explicit approval before publishing to the internal registry. Minor and patch releases may proceed after automated checks pass, but breaking changes must include a migration guide reviewed by at least two consuming teams. Release managers should not tag a major release without written sign-off. Final approval authority for all major version releases rests with the person named below.

named custodian: Oliath Ralax